Course details

Thermodynamics and Heat Transfer: Understanding the fundamental principles of thermodynamics and heat transfer is crucial for effective data center heat management. This unit covers topics such as conduction, convection, and radiation, as well as the first and second laws of thermodynamics.

Data Center Design and Infrastructure: This unit explores the physical design of data centers, including rack layout, cable management, and airflow management. It also covers the role of infrastructure components such as computer room air conditioning (CRAC) units, chillers, and humidifiers.

Temperature and Humidity Control: Maintaining appropriate temperature and humidity levels is essential for the reliable operation of data center equipment. This unit covers best practices for temperature and humidity control, including the use of sensors and monitoring systems.

Power and Cooling Efficiency: This unit focuses on strategies for improving the efficiency of data center power and cooling systems. Topics covered include power usage effectiveness (PUE), data center infrastructure efficiency (DCIE), and free cooling.

Monitoring and Analytics: Effective data center heat management requires real-time monitoring and analytics capabilities. This unit covers the latest technologies and tools for monitoring data center temperatures, humidity levels, and energy usage.

Sustainable Data Center Strategies: This unit explores the latest trends and best practices in sustainable data center design and operation. Topics covered include renewable energy, waste heat recovery, and carbon footprint reduction.

Data Center Operations and Maintenance: Proper operations and maintenance are essential for ensuring the long-term sustainability of data center heat management systems. This unit covers best practices for routine ma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air.
